- 💻 Experienced Full-Stack Developer with 12+ years on GitHub
- 🏗️ Passionate about building scalable applications and clean architectures
- 📚 Strong advocate for Clean Code principles and SOLID design patterns
- 🌟 Maintaining 244 public repositories with active contributions
- 👥 Part of a vibrant developer community with 64 followers
- 💼 Open to exciting opportunities and collaborations
- 📧 Contact me: horsekit1982@gmail.com
React ████████████████████░ 95%
TypeScript ███████████████████░░ 90%
JavaScript ████████████████████░ 95%
HTML/CSS ████████████████████░ 95%
Go ██████████████████░░░ 85%
Node.js ███████████████████░░ 90%
PostgreSQL ████████████████████░ 95%
Docker ███████████████████░░ 90%
Kubernetes ██████████████░░░░░░░ 70%
- Architecture: Microservices, Clean Architecture, Domain-Driven Design
- Communication: gRPC, REST APIs, WebSocket
- Database: PostgreSQL, MySQL, TiDB, Redis
- DevOps: Docker, Kubernetes, CI/CD, GitHub Actions
- Testing: Unit Testing, Integration Testing, TDD
- Version Control: Git, GitHub Flow
- 🔧 Clean Code Mastery: Implementing SOLID principles and DRY patterns across all projects
- 🚀 Modern Architecture: Building microservices with Go and gRPC
- 🎯 Full-Stack Excellence: Creating seamless user experiences with React and TypeScript
- 📈 Performance Optimization: Database tuning and application scaling
- 🤝 Team Collaboration: Mentoring and knowledge sharing through code reviews
- 📝 Documentation: Writing comprehensive technical documentation and best practices
"Clean code always looks like it was written by someone who cares." - Robert C. Martin
I believe in:
- Single Responsibility Principle: Every module should have one reason to change
- Open/Closed Principle: Software entities should be open for extension, closed for modification
- DRY (Don't Repeat Yourself): Every piece of knowledge should have a single representation
- Continuous Learning: Technology evolves, and so should we
- Quality over Quantity: Better to have 10 excellent repositories than 100 mediocre ones
- 🗓️ GitHub Journey: Started my GitHub journey in August 2012
- 📦 Repository Count: Maintaining 244+ public repositories
- 🌟 Open Source: Believe in the power of open source collaboration
- 💡 Problem Solver: Love tackling complex technical challenges
- 📚 Continuous Learner: Always exploring new technologies and best practices
- 🤝 Team Player: Enjoy mentoring and knowledge sharing
"Code is like humor. When you have to explain it, it's bad." – Cory House
⭐️ From horsekitlin with ❤️



